This study will test the hypothesis that treating mild asthmatics with rhumAb-E25 reduced Fc&RI expression and signaling activity in lung mast cells as it does in basophils and to determine if IgE removal impairs basophil Fc&RI stability and Fc&RI-kinase coupling. a. To measure effects of rhumAb25 treatment and withdrawal on Fc&RI levels and Fc&RI-mediated degranulation in the lung mast cells and blood basophils of mild asthmatics. b. To explore effects of IgE removal on the stability of Fc&RI subunit interactions and on Fc&RI-kinase coupling in basophils.
